The Challenge: An Outdated Basement in Need of Rescue
Before we started this project, the basement was… well, let’s just say it was a DIY dream gone wrong. The previous homeowner had attempted some basement finishing, but the work left behind was uneven, out of code, and barely functional. From electrical oddities to poor framing and an inefficient layout, it was clear this space needed a full gut and a fresh plan.
The basement had no bathroom, the lighting was dim, and the old drop ceilings made the space feel more like a maze than a living area. Guests coming in from the pool had to trek upstairs through the kitchen just to use the restroom. To make matters worse, nearly 40% of the square footage was being wasted as storage. The Construction Journey: Making the Vision Real
No basement remodeling in MO is without its challenges. This one included:
Egress Window Woes
Because the new bedroom was below grade, we needed an egress window for safety. The existing windows were too small and too high. So, we brought in a concrete crew to cut a new opening and frame in a proper escape route. Safety first—and code compliant!
Support Post Headaches
The new bathroom landed smack-dab in line with a major support post. Our architect and structural engineer developed a plan to remove it and reinforce the beam above with welded steel. It took careful execution—but we made it work.
Septic System Constraints
The house was on a septic system, and the drain line exited about 5 feet off the basement floor. To make the bathroom functional, we had to trench nearly 75 linear feet of concrete to run new drain lines—no small feat.

Products That Deliver Style & Durability
The homeowners wanted quality without going overboard. We delivered with stylish, durable materials designed to handle the chaos of parties, kids, and pool days.
- Cabinetry: Waypoint 400 Series in Maple Slate. Sleek, modern, and built to last. We completed the look with sleek cabinet hardware pulls in brushed pewter finish.
- Flooring: 1,300+ sq. ft. of luxury vinyl tile (LVT) with a thick wear layer, perfect for high-traffic areas.
- Trim & Doors: All new doors, casing, and tall baseboards replaced the beat-up originals.
- Lighting: Custom-designed layout with recessed and accent lights to brighten every corner.
The Timeline: From Demo to Done in 5 Months
This basement finishing project in St Louis took roughly five months from start to finish. Here’s how it all unfolded:
- Weeks 1–3: Demo and surprises—yes, we found a few! We also marked the egress window and finalized wall locations.
- Weeks 4–6: Trenching for plumbing, concrete removal, and ground inspections. HVAC and electrical rough-ins followed.
- Week 7: Framing and rough inspections passed with flying colors.
- Weeks 8–9: Drywall installed and primed. STL County checked fasteners and spacing.
- Weeks 10–11: Homeowners tackled the painting. (We always love a little DIY spirit.)
- Week 12: Flooring installed—1500 square feet of gorgeous, durable LVT.
- Week 13: Doors, trim, exterior patio door, and egress window set in place.
- Week 14–15: Cabinets arrived, counters templated, shower tile installed.
- Week 16–17: Countertops and plumbing fixtures installed, final trim work completed.
- Final Stretch: Bar backsplash tiled, glass shower doors installed, final HVAC and electrical finishes wrapped up.
